The map above shows British Columbia and Italy side by side at exactly the same scale, using equal-area projections, so their true relative sizes are preserved.

British Columbia vs Italy Geography

Land area: British Columbia has a land area of 357,216 square miles (925,186 km²), while Italy has 113,568 square miles (294,140 km²). British Columbia's land area is 3.1 times (215%) larger than Italy's.

Total area: British Columbia: 364,764 square miles (944,735 km²) vs Italy: 116,348 square miles (301,340 km²), including inland and coastal water. British Columbia's total area is 3.1 times (214%) larger than Italy's.

Length: British Columbia is 1,017 miles (1,637 km) long from north to south; Italy is 734 miles (1,181 km). British Columbia's north-south length is 1.4 times (39%) longer than Italy's.

Width: British Columbia spans 1,245 miles (2,003 km) east to west; Italy spans 694 miles (1,117 km). British Columbia's east-west width is 1.8 times (79%) wider than Italy's.

Highest point: British Columbia's highest point is Mount Fairweather at 15,299 feet (4,663 m); Italy's is Monte Bianco (Mont Blanc) at 15,778 feet (4,809 m). Monte Bianco (Mont Blanc) is 479 feet higher than Mount Fairweather.

Lowest point: British Columbia's lowest point is Pacific Ocean at 0 feet; Italy's is Jolanda di Savoia at -10 feet. Italy's lowest point is 10 feet lower.

British Columbia vs Italy Population and History

Population: British Columbia has a population of 5,658,528 (2026), while Italy has 58,943,673 (2026). Italy's population is 10.4 times larger than British Columbia's.

Population density: British Columbia: 15.8 people per square mile vs Italy: 519.0. Italy's population density is 32.8 times higher than British Columbia's.

Biggest city: British Columbia's biggest city is Vancouver with 662,248 people; Italy's is Rome with 2,748,109. Rome's population is 4.1 times (315%) larger than Vancouver's.

Largest metro area: British Columbia's largest metropolitan area is Vancouver CMA (2,642,825 people) vs Italy's Metropolitan City of Rome (4,223,885). Metropolitan City of Rome's population is 1.6 times (60%) larger than Vancouver CMA's.

History: British Columbia: Joined Confederation on July 20, 1871. Italy: Unified as the Kingdom of Italy on March 17, 1861; a republic since 1946. In its current form, Italy is the older of the two by 10 years.

British Columbia vs Italy Economy

GDP: British Columbia's GDP is $313.3 billion (2024) vs Italy's $2,551.6 billion. Italy's economic output is 8.1 times (714%) larger than British Columbia's.

GDP per capita: British Columbia: $55,241 per person vs Italy: $43,309. British Columbia's GDP per capita is 1.3 times (28%) higher than Italy's.
